## Description

INSTANT NEW YORK TIMES BESTSELLER “Most appealing... technical accuracy and lightness of tone ... Impeccable. ” —Wall Street Journal “ A porthole into another world. ” —Scientific American “ Brings science dissemination to a new level. ” —Science The most trusted explainer of the most mind-boggling concepts pulls back the veil of mystery that has too long cloaked the most valuable building blocks of modern science. Sean Carroll, with his genius for making complex notions entertaining, presents in his uniquely lucid voice the fundamental ideas informing the modern physics of reality. Physics offers deep insights into the workings of the universe but those insights come in the form of equations that often look like gobbledygook. Sean Carroll shows that they are really like meaningful poems that can help us fly over sierras to discover a miraculous multidimensional landscape alive with radiant giants, warped space-time, and bewilderingly powerful forces. High school calculus is itself a centuries-old marvel as worthy of our gaze as the Mona Lisa. And it may come as a surprise the extent to which all our most cutting-edge ideas about black holes are built on the math calculus enables. No one else could so smoothly guide readers toward grasping the very equation Einstein used to describe his theory of general relativity. In the tradition of the legendary Richard Feynman lectures presented sixty years ago, this book is an inspiring, dazzling introduction to a way of seeing that will resonate across cultural and generational boundaries for many years to come.

### ⭐⭐⭐⭐ The money line: “We don’t know the final laws of physics..."
*by G***R on November 20, 2022*

In reading the professional reviews of Carroll’s books I get the impression that he is the Carl Sagan of physics. His enthusiasm is palpable, his desire to bring physics into the mainstream is obviously sincere, and he makes a laudatory attempt to explain that physics is often, but not always, as advanced as the mass audience is often led to believe. Contrary to what the Wall Street Journal writes in its Amazon review, however, this book is not “reader-friendly,” assuming, of course, you do not have an advanced degree in physics or some variation of advanced calculus. For the rest of us, it is a very challenging read. And while that is not meant with any disrespect to the author, who is obviously brilliant and sincere, it is a warning to any potential reader looking for a comfortable winter read in front of the fire. I will, however, give Carroll great credit for not over-playing the hand of physics. He openly admits that physics, and by implication, science in general, is not the hard, granite-like “truth” that contemporary society often portrays it to be. “The science says” is often used today, with great exaggeration, in many news articles attempting to reinforce a conclusion that is far from conclusive in any final sense. Science is not like the ancient bone we dig up at an archeological dig. It is more like the conjecture we assign to that bone. Science, in fact, is not a body of knowledge at all. It is a methodology, or the outline of one, for discovering knowledge. But it is the equation, not its solution. And it is an equation that can take many different forms. There is not one equation, or very, very few, that rise to the level of “law.” Mathematics is no different. We didn’t “discover” it buried deep in the earth somewhere. We – humans – developed it. As the author notes, equations are “just a way to compactly summarize a relationship between different quantities.” And “A function is simply a map from one quantity to another quantity.” Mathematics, in other words, is simply a system or notation used to attempt to understand the world around us – emphasis on attempt. As a result, there are several models of reality, all mathematically “sound”, but often burdened by gaps and even contradictions between models. As Carroll notes, “We don’t know the final laws of physics, so we should be open to different possibilities while we think about what they might be.” And that, to me, is the money line of the book, which extends far beyond physics itself. “Science is empirical and fallibilistic – any of our scientific theories could be wrong, no matter how much evidence we have so far accumulated for them.” Which is why so many, and I do mean many, scientific theories are ultimately proven wrong and why things like clinical drug trials are often impossible to replicate. I attribute this to the infinitely broad umbrella of context. Nothing that we can observe or measure exists in total isolation. Context cannot, and in my mind never will be, reduced to notation, no matter how complex that notational language may be. Context is of infinite breadth and, perhaps more importantly, depth. Which is why I believe the title itself, with its use of the concept of “ideas”, is a bit inappropriate. Spacetime, to me, is not an idea. Beauty is an idea. Spacetime is a system for explaining one component of reality, but not, of and by itself, a piece of reality we found while hiking in the mountains. Ideas, to my way of thinking, are like shiny objects we discover in the rumpled fabric of reality. Having said all that, this is a very sound book for the right reader. If you are not already proficient in the notational language of calculus and physics, however, you will find it a difficult read. I will confess, however, there are moments of entertainment if you define entertainment as anything that brings anything positioned “beyond” us down to our very human level of understanding. Perhaps its greatest contribution, however, is that it does distill the greatest “laws” of physics posed to date into one modest-sized book. And it makes a valiant effort to tie them all together with a bow. That’s no small undertaking given that tomes have been written about most of them individually. For that the author is deserving of our thanks and our admiration and, if you’re up to it, our purchase.
